New Middle Class is Barbara Borok (lead vocal) and Mike Borok (guitar/vocal). Their many songwriter awards include Grand Prize in the 2003 MTL Songwriting Contest at the prestigious Kerrville Folk Festival in Texas and, most recently, finalist in the 2019 S. Florida FolkFest Songwriting Contest. They sing about relationships and current events gone awry, the origin of the universe, and desserts. ... more
